Commonly, a catalytic converter operates the principle of catalysis, where chain reactions are facilitated by a stimulant, usually made from rare-earth elements such as palladium, rhodium, and platinum. The catalytic converter jobs by transforming hazardous discharges like carbon monoxide (CO), hydrocarbons (HC), and nitrogen oxides (NOx) right into much less unsafe substances such as co2 (CO2) and nitrogen (N2). This procedure is vital for reducing the carbon footprint of cars and boosting air top quality in city areas, where web traffic is usually dense. The mini catalytic converter uses the exact same catalytic residential or commercial properties as larger designs, guaranteeing that they effectively reduce dangerous emissions while taking up considerably less space.

Along with their seat at the forefront of vehicle technology, mini catalytic converters additionally play a function in advertising sustainability in the automotive supply chain. The usage of important products such as rhodium, platinum, and palladium needs strategic sourcing and reusing initiatives. Many makers are implementing programs to recuperate and reuse these precious steels from old or damaged catalytic converters, decreasing waste and reducing the environmental influence of extracting new products. This round economic situation method straightens with the expanding trend of sustainability in producing techniques, making mini catalytic converters a contributor to eco-friendly efforts past their primary function.
